Method

Crust Preparation

  1. 1

    Make the Dough

    In a large bowl, combine the all-purpose flour and salt. Add the cubed chilled butter and mix until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s.

  2. 2

    Add Water

    Gradually add the ice water, one tablespoon at a time, mixing until the dough holds together. Do not overmix.

  3. 3

    Chill the Dough

    Shape the dough into a disk, wrap in plastic wrap, and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es.

Quiche Filling Preparation

  1. 4

    Sauté Spinach

    In a skillet over medium heat, add the fresh spinach and sauté until wilted, about 3-4 minutes. Remove from heat and let cool slightly.

  2. 5

    Whisk Egg Mixture

    In a mixing bowl, whisk together the eggs, heavy cream, nutmeg, salt, and black pepper until well combined.

  3. 6

    Combine Ingredients

    Add the sautéed spinach and grated Gruyère cheese to the egg mixture and stir until evenly distributed.

Assembly and Baking

  1. 7

    Preheat Oven

    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).

  2. 8

    Roll Out Dough

    On a floured surface, roll out the chilled dough into a circle large enough to fit a 9-inch pie dish. Transfer to the dish and trim the edges.

  3. 9

    Fill the Crust

    Pour the spinach and cheese mixture into the prepared crust, spreading it evenly.

  4. 10

    Bake

    Bake the quiche for 30-35 minutes, or until the filling is set and the top is lightly golden.

  5. 11

    Cool and Serve

    Allow the quiche to cool for 10 minutes before slicing and serving.

Salad and Vinaigrette Preparation

  1. 12

    Prepare Salad

    In a large bowl, combine the mixed salad greens, halved cherry tomatoes, and sliced cucumber.

  2. 13

    Make Vinaigrette

    In a small bowl, whisk together the sherry vinegar, olive oil, Dijon mustard, honey, salt, and black pepper until emulsified.

  3. 14

    Dress the Salad

    Drizzle the vinaigrette over the salad and toss gently to combine.
